## About Sublime Text
Sublime Text is a sophisticated, cross-platform text and source code editor renowned for its speed, efficiency, and extensive customization options. Designed for developers and writers alike, it offers a clean interface with powerful features that enhance productivity and streamline workflows. Key Features and Functionality: - Multiple Selections: Allows users to make multiple changes simultaneously, enhancing editing efficiency. - Command Palette: Provides quick access to commands, reducing the need for complex menu navigation. - Split Editing: Enables side-by-side editing of files, facilitating comparison and multitasking. - Instant Project Switch: Allows seamless switching between projects without saving prompts, maintaining context and workflow continuity. - Customization: Offers extensive customization through JSON settings files, including key bindings, menus, and snippets. - Plugin API: Supports a robust Python-based API, allowing users to extend functionality with plugins. - Cross-Platform Support: Available on Windows, macOS, and Linux, ensuring a consistent experience across different operating systems. Primary Value and User Solutions: Sublime Text addresses the need for a fast, reliable, and highly customizable text editor that caters to the diverse requirements of developers and writers. Its lightweight design ensures quick startup times and responsiveness, even with large files. The editor&#39;s flexibility allows users to tailor the environment to their specific needs, enhancing productivity. Features like multiple selections and split editing streamline complex editing tasks, while the extensive plugin ecosystem enables the addition of specialized functionalities. By providing a distraction-free interface combined with powerful tools, Sublime Text empowers users to focus on their work and achieve optimal results.



## Sublime Text Pros & Cons
**What users like:**

- Users value the **ease of use** of Sublime Text, enabling efficient coding with a simple and intuitive interface. (32 reviews)
- Users praise the **speed and lightweight nature** of Sublime Text, ensuring a smooth coding experience without lag. (22 reviews)
- Users love the **fast and lightweight performance** of Sublime Text, enhancing their coding experience seamlessly. (16 reviews)
- Users love the **extensive language support** of Sublime Text, making coding and feature integration seamless and efficient. (14 reviews)
- Users appreciate the **lightweight and fast performance** of Sublime Text, enhancing focus and productivity during writing and coding. (10 reviews)
- Users laud the **exceptional speed and performance** of Sublime Text, enhancing their overall coding productivity. (10 reviews)
- Users love the **minimal and fast user interface** of Sublime Text, enhancing their writing and coding experience seamlessly. (10 reviews)
- Users highlight the **efficiency** of Sublime Text, enabling quick edits and seamless navigation for optimal productivity. (8 reviews)
- Users love the **lightweight nature** of Sublime Text, allowing for fast and efficient coding without distractions. (8 reviews)
- Cross-Platform (7 reviews)

**What users dislike:**

- Users note a **lack of features** in Sublime Text, particularly compared to modern IDEs like VSCode. (8 reviews)
- Users often face a **lack of IDE features** in Sublime Text, leading to a fragmented development experience. (7 reviews)
- Users find that **plugin issues** create fragmentation, making Sublime Text feel less cohesive than full IDEs. (7 reviews)
- Users criticize the **high cost and push for premium upgrades** , feeling it detracts from the overall experience. (5 reviews)
- Users find the lack of **built-in debugging tools** in Sublime Text limits its functionality compared to full IDEs. (5 reviews)
- Users find Sublime Text&#39;s price to be **expensive compared to free alternatives** , limiting its appeal for some users. (4 reviews)
- Users notice the **slow update frequency** of Sublime Text, leading to delays in support for new programming languages. (4 reviews)
- Autocomplete Issues (3 reviews)
- Lack of Cloud Integration (3 reviews)
- Users find the **lack of built-in collaboration features** limits teamwork, making real-time project work more challenging. (3 reviews)

  ### 32. Efficiency amplified in Sublime Text

**Rating:** 5.0/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Anjana P. | Software Engineer, Mid-Market (51-1000 em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** June 15, 2023

**What do you like best about Sublime Text?**

I love that Sublime Text is lightweight and fast. It's remarkably fast and efficient, allowing you to work on your coding without experiencing any lag, even when heavy resource-consuming applications run in the background. It's cross-platform and works on Windows, macOS, and Linux, which is a considerable benefit as it allows you to seamlessly work across different OS, including the widely favored one among programmers in Linux. The extensivity in customization offered by Sublime Text is excellent. You can change the theme, color schemes, and keyboard hotkeys. You can cater the editor to your preference and boost productivity by having essential tools on easy-to-access hotkeys. Like other IDEs, Sublime Text offers many features to help your coding, like syntax highlighting, auto-completion, search and replace function, and multiple tab support. Features that Sublime Text lacks can easily be implemented with plugins and packages found on the website. You can improve functionality, add support for programming languages that aren't built-in, and more.

**What do you dislike about Sublime Text?**

Sublime Text is closed-source, so you cannot modify the IDE to meet specific needs. It also heavily lacks built-in collaboration features, making it less viable for real-time collaborative editing.

**What problems is Sublime Text solving and how is that benefiting you?**

Sublime Text is what I use for code editing during work. It provides a perfect environment for writing and editing code, providing features like code folding, multi-cursor editing, split editing, etc. These features make it ideal for software development projects. We can seamlessly organize our projects within Sublime Text by creating project-specific settings and quickly navigating between files and folders. It also has support for integrating external build systems, so we can compile and run code within the editor without using another compiler just for compilation. One significant benefit of Sublime Text is that with the help of plugins like Package Control, we can automate many tasks for convenience. These tasks include package management, linting, running tests, and improving our workflow efficiency. Sublime Text also has broad language support, making it viable for writing and editing in any language. It integrates seamlessly with GitHub, allowing us to quickly make push requests and merges. Our productivity has significantly increased after we collectively started using Sublime Text over other IDEs for daily coding and quick editing.

  ### 34. Best Editor for quick formatting and Note taking

**Rating:** 4.5/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** K Madhusudan C. | Software Engineer, Mid-Market (51-1000 em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** August 11, 2023

**What do you like best about Sublime Text?**

Quick toll for not taking and formatting text. I have used it for json formatting and also store some texts. Also editing code. The main advantage is it supports wide range of file types. Sometimes I used to see the hexadecimal view of some compressed files

**What do you dislike about Sublime Text?**

Nothing much some times it lags while opening big files. No much customisation. Less plugins and Not automatic saving. GUI can be modren and improved. Need much more UI updated

**What problems is Sublime Text solving and how is that benefiting you?**

Use it for minor code edits instead of VIm. Use it for formatting json files and viewing the hexadecimal values for a compressed file like pickle. Sometimes I use it to analyse log files that I download from servers
